
Bio
​Jansen is a rising designer whose work spans from viral digital content, to national brand campaigns, in personal visual marketing, and award-winning independent films.
​
Jansen was in the art department of a Youtube production company with over 32 million subscribers across multiple platforms, and recently graduated from the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ences Academy Gold Rising Program for production design.
While Jansen loves working in film, she has also worked with commercial brands to elevate their stores. She is a lead on the 'Less Than Three' design team that has traveled around the country for the restaurant chain Eataly to help decorate for the holidays, redress their restaurants, and open brand new locations. Jansen has also art directed four ad campaigns for XPLR, a brand owned by social media stars Sam & Colby. Each campaign has been shown online and in person at the clothing store Zumiez.
​
Recently, she was given the opportunity to act as the set decorator on the newest season of Josh Richards sketch comedy show "Read the Room". She partnered with Emmy Award winning crew members, SNL veterans, and winners of the Screen Actors Guild Award to decorate fantastical and immersive sets to elevate the stories.
​
Jansen most recently was awarded Best Production Design for her work on "Glodok '98" in the Indie Shorts Fest.
